Tovah's Story

Soft and fluffy like a marshmallow and sweet as cotton candy would best describe 12-year-old Tovah. This quiet, mellow girl has shown tremendous growth in her foster home and now she is searching for a forever home that will continue to provide nurturing and consistency in order to continue to boost her confidence. Tovah can be anxious at times which will cause her to circle, however, she is making great strides and learning to relax and experience the joys of being a dog: puzzle toys, zoomies, bedtime cuddles, and more! Tovah is figuring out potty-training and will give her person signals when she needs to go outside. Walks are one of her very favorite activities and she certainly builds up an appetite while she is out and about because this little girl gets very excited about mealtime!<br/><br/>Tovah would thrive in a home where her person is home much of the time to offer guidance and a routine. She likes to be where the action is and does well with all people, dogs, and cats, however, she prefers to do her own thing rather than directly engage in the goings on. This adorable little ball of fluff is so ready for a home to call her own and to show you how eager she is to continue her progress!

Our Mission
Forever Loved Pet Sanctuary (FLPS) is the only senior-only animal rescues in Maricopa County, Arizona. Formed in 2012 as a non-profit 501[c][3] organization, the focus of FLPS is to save senior animals who are often overlooked by providing them the opportunity to thrive in a safe and caring environment.
